The Science of Hydration: Beyond "Drink More Water"

Modern hydration science emphasizes that fluid balance is a dynamic, individualized process influenced by body size, sweat rate, climate, activity level and even cultural and workplace norms, and research summarized by The European Food Safety Authority and the European Hydration Institute underscores that mild dehydration can impair cognitive functions such as attention, working memory and decision-making, which has direct implications for both athletes and knowledge workers who must sustain focus for extended periods. In high-performance sport, organizations like World Athletics now routinely integrate hydration strategies into competition protocols, while in the corporate world, forward-looking employers in regions from North America to Scandinavia are beginning to treat hydration as a component of occupational health, recognizing that even a 1-2% loss in body mass from fluid deficit can reduce mental performance and increase fatigue.

From a nutritional standpoint, hydration is not only about water intake but also about the balance of electrolytes, particularly sodium, potassium, magnesium and calcium, which regulate fluid distribution, nerve conduction and muscle contraction; resources such as the Academy of Nutrition and Dietetics provide accessible overviews of how these minerals interact with fluid intake and why simply consuming large volumes of plain water can, in some circumstances, dilute plasma sodium and contribute to hyponatremia in endurance events. Electrolytes, Minerals and the Role of Smart Supplementation

As consumer awareness has grown, the global market for electrolyte beverages, powders and functional waters has expanded rapidly, with major brands and emerging startups alike competing for shelf space and digital visibility, yet not all products are created equal, and evidence-based guidance remains essential for avoiding both under- and over-supplementation. Institutions like the Mayo Clinic and Cleveland Clinic have highlighted that while most individuals can meet their mineral needs through balanced diets rich in fruits, vegetables, whole grains and dairy or fortified alternatives, specific populations such as endurance athletes, outdoor workers and individuals in hot climates may benefit from targeted electrolyte strategies, particularly during prolonged exercise or heat waves.

In 2026, data from wearables and sweat-testing services, championed by companies like WHOOP, Oura and specialized sports labs affiliated with universities in the United States, the United Kingdom and Germany, allow serious athletes and teams to quantify sweat composition and tailor electrolyte intake accordingly. Everyday Nutrition Habits That Support Hydration

While advanced tools and specialized products attract attention, the foundation of effective hydration is built through daily nutrition habits that most people can implement regardless of geography or budget, and this is where FitBuzzFeed's global readership-from Canada and France to South Africa and Japan-can benefit from integrating practical, culturally adaptable routines. High-water-content foods such as cucumbers, tomatoes, oranges, berries, melons and leafy greens contribute significantly to total fluid intake, and research from the Harvard T.H. Chan School of Public Health notes that these foods also deliver vitamins, antioxidants and fiber, which support metabolic health and recovery processes. Combining these foods with sources of lean protein and complex carbohydrates creates meals that not only hydrate but also stabilize blood sugar and energy levels, an important factor for sustaining performance throughout the workday and during evening workouts.

Public health organizations, including the Centers for Disease Control and Prevention, continue to advise limiting consumption of sugar-sweetened drinks, which can contribute to weight gain and metabolic disorders, and instead encourage water, unsweetened tea and, when appropriate, low-fat milk or fortified plant beverages as primary hydration sources, with coffee and moderate caffeine intake integrated thoughtfully, especially for those sensitive to diuretic effects.

Recovery Nutrition: Rebuilding, Adapting and Protecting the Body

Recovery is no longer seen as passive rest but as an active, strategically nourished phase in which the body repairs tissues, replenishes energy stores and adapts to training stimuli, and this paradigm is deeply embedded in the editorial direction of FitBuzzFeed's fitness and training coverage. Leading institutions such as the American College of Sports Medicine and the International Olympic Committee emphasize that optimal recovery nutrition focuses on three key pillars: adequate protein to support muscle repair and remodeling, carbohydrates to restore glycogen and support subsequent training sessions, and fluids and electrolytes to normalize hydration status. This triad applies not only to Olympic-level competitors in South Korea or Italy but also to recreational runners in the Netherlands and busy professionals in Singapore who train before or after long workdays.

Protein quality and distribution across the day matter; evidence synthesized in journals accessible via PubMed suggests that consuming 20-40 grams of high-quality protein within a few hours after training, and repeating similar doses every three to four hours, can maximize muscle protein synthesis in many adults, with adjustments for older individuals who may require slightly higher doses due to anabolic resistance. Carbohydrate intake should be tailored to training volume and intensity, with endurance athletes in sports like cycling, football and long-distance running typically requiring more aggressive replenishment strategies than individuals engaged in moderate strength or mixed-modal training. Fluids and electrolytes complete the picture by restoring plasma volume, supporting circulation and enabling effective nutrient delivery to recovering tissues.

Global Trends: Cultural, Climatic and Regional Differences

Because FitBuzzFeed serves a global audience spanning North America, Europe, Asia, Africa and South America, it is important to recognize that hydration and recovery practices are influenced by climate, cultural norms, food availability and regulatory frameworks, and that best practices must be adapted rather than copied wholesale from one region to another. In hot and humid countries such as Thailand, Malaysia and Brazil, the risk of heat stress during outdoor activities is higher, and public health agencies, including the World Meteorological Organization, increasingly issue heat-related advisories that emphasize fluid intake, electrolyte management and activity modification during peak temperature periods. In contrast, colder climates in Scandinavia, Canada and parts of Japan may create a false sense of security, as individuals often underestimate sweat loss and fluid needs when temperatures are low but training intensity is high, particularly in winter sports and indoor heated environments.

Dietary patterns also shape hydration and recovery options; Mediterranean countries like Italy and Spain benefit from culinary traditions rich in fruits, vegetables, olive oil and seafood, which naturally support hydration and anti-inflammatory recovery, while some regions rely more heavily on processed foods and sugary beverages, creating additional challenges.
